What does a mechanical contractor do?

A Mechanical Contractor specializes in the installation, maintenance, and repair of heating, ventilation, air conditioning (HVAC), plumbing, and other mechanical systems in residential, commercial, and industrial buildings. They ensure that these systems function efficiently and comply with building codes and regulations. Mechanical Contractors often work on large-scale projects, coordinating with other construction professionals to complete jobs on time and within budget.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a mechanical contractor?

To thrive as a Mechanical Contractor, you need strong expertise in mechanical systems installation, maintenance, and project management, often supported by a relevant trade license or degree. Familiarity with HVAC and plumbing systems, blueprint reading, CAD software, and compliance with building codes is essential, along with certifications such as OSHA safety training. Strong leadership, problem-solving abilities, and effective communication skills help you coordinate teams and work closely with clients and other trades. These competencies ensure projects are completed efficiently, safely, and to specification, which is critical for client satisfaction and ongoing business success.

Job Summary
Paragon Mechanical is hiring a Piping Estimator to support the company’s commercial and industrial piping division.
This is a hands-on estimating role for someone who is detail-oriented, organized, and comfortable reviewing plans, performing takeoffs, requesting vendor and subcontractor pricing, and preparing accurate estimates for mechanical piping projects.
The right candidate will be able to read and understand bid documents, communicate clearly with general contractors and vendors, maintain accurate project information, and work closely with senior leadership and project managers to help Paragon submit complete, competitive, and accurate bids.
This role is ideal for someone with experience in mechanical construction, commercial or industrial piping, construction takeoffs, or estimating support who is looking to grow within a well-established mechanical contractor.
What You’ll Do
  • Review bid documents, drawings, specifications, scope sheets, and project requirements
  • Perform detailed piping takeoffs for commercial and industrial mechanical construction projects
  • Request quotes from vendors, subcontractors, and suppliers
  • Build complete and accurate estimates for labor, materials, equipment, and subcontractor costs
  • Use Paragon’s estimating and software systems to prepare and maintain bid information
  • Track and organize project information, bid documents, proposals, change orders, and related communications
  • Communicate with general contractors, vendors, purchasing, internal team members, and clients
  • Work closely with senior executives, project managers, and operations teams to ensure estimates align with project goals, scope, timelines, and budgets
  • Attend job walks, bid reviews, project meetings, and internal coordination meetings as needed
  • Help maintain accurate records, change order logs, proposal information, and project-related documentation
  • Support a smooth handoff from estimating to project management once projects are awarded
